Denver Green School Community Farm

The Denver Green School Community Farm

In the spring of 2011, Sprout City Farms began to establish and maintain a one-acre farm site on the grounds of The Denver Green School (DGS) in SE Denver (see map). Working in collaboration with DGS and Denver Urban Gardens the farm provides:

  • Fresh veggies and herbs to the school cafeteria
  • A CSA program and school farm stand for the neighborhood residents and school community
  • Food- and farm-related education programs for youth and adults
  • Seasonal internship program
  • Hands-on volunteer opportunities
  • Produce donations to local food banks and qualifying families
